About GRML Greenland Mines Ltd. Common Stock

Greenland Mines Ltd operates in two divisions: (1) Natural Resources, focused on the exploration and development of the Skaergaard Project in Southeast Greenland, an undeveloped palladium, gold, and platinum deposit; and 2) Cell and Gene Therapy, which focuses on the development of biologic, cell, and gene therapies for neurodegenerative and age-related disorders, including Alzheimer's, am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S), Parkinson's, and related conditions, targeting areas of high unmet medical need.

About MBINN Merchants Bancorp

Merchants Bancorp is a United States based bank holding company. It operates multiple lines of business focusing on FHA (Federal Housing Administration) multi-family housing and healthcare facility financing and servicing, retail and correspondent residential mortgage banking, and traditional community banking. The business segments of the company are: Multi-family Mortgage Banking which originates and services government-sponsored mortgages for multi-family and healthcare facilities; Mortgage Warehousing segment which funds agency-eligible residential loans as well as commercial loans to nondepository financial institutions; and the Banking segment, which generates maximum revenue, and provides various financial products and services to consumers and businesses.
